Urgent Care Market - Report Scope:

Urgent care centers provide immediate medical attention for non-life-threatening conditions, bridging the gap between primary care and emergency departments. These centers offer walk-in medical services, diagnostic testing, and minor procedures, catering to patients seeking prompt treatment without long hospital wait times. The urgent care market is expanding due to rising healthcare demands, increasing patient preference for convenience, and the growing burden on emergency rooms. The market encompasses a wide range of services, including general illness treatment, injury care, vaccination, diagnostic services, and occupational health programs.

Market Growth Drivers:

The global urgent care market is propelled by several key factors, including the increasing prevalence of acute and chronic diseases, rising healthcare costs, and a growing emphasis on outpatient care. The demand for cost-effective and accessible healthcare solutions has led to a surge in urgent care center visits, reducing the strain on emergency departments. Advancements in telemedicine, digital check-ins, and electronic health records (EHR) integration are further enhancing operational efficiency and patient experiences. Additionally, the expansion of insurance coverage for urgent care services and the shift towards value-based healthcare models contribute to market growth.

Market Restraints:

Despite promising growth prospects, the urgent care market faces challenges such as regulatory complexities, physician shortages, and competition from retail clinics and telehealth providers. Stringent licensing requirements and state-specific healthcare regulations create barriers for new entrants. Furthermore, reimbursement limitations from insurance providers and the lack of standardized pricing models hinder market expansion. Addressing workforce shortages and ensuring quality care while maintaining profitability remains a key challenge for urgent care operators.

Market Opportunities:

The urgent care market presents significant growth opportunities driven by technological innovations, partnerships, and service diversification. The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and remote patient monitoring enhances diagnostic accuracy and treatment efficiency. The expansion of hybrid care models, combining in-person and virtual consultations, broadens patient access to urgent care services. Additionally, strategic collaborations between urgent care centers, hospitals, and insurance providers facilitate seamless healthcare delivery and drive market growth. Investments in advanced diagnostic equipment and expanded specialty services, such as pediatric and geriatric urgent care, offer lucrative business prospects.

Competitive Intelligence and Business Strategy:

Leading players in the global urgent care market, including MedExpress, CityMD, FastMed Urgent Care, and NextCare Holdings, focus on expanding their geographic presence, enhancing service offerings, and leveraging digital health technologies. These companies invest in telemedicine platforms, mobile apps, and AI-driven diagnostics to improve patient engagement and streamline operations. Collaborations with healthcare providers, insurance firms, and retail chains strengthen market positioning and enhance accessibility. Moreover, emphasis on quality accreditation, patient satisfaction, and data-driven decision-making supports long-term growth and industry leadership in the dynamic urgent care landscape.
